1. Overview of Selous Game Reserve
Established in 1922 and named after the famous hunter and explorer Frederick Selous, this UNESCO World Heritage Site covers over 50,000 square kilometers (approximately 19,000 square miles). It features a variety of habitats, including savannahs, riverine forests, wetlands, and miombo woodlands, making it a haven for wildlife.
2. Unique Wildlife Encounters
Selous is renowned for its rich biodiversity and offers diverse wildlife experiences:
- Big Game Viewing: The reserve is home to large populations of elephants, buffaloes, lions, leopards, and wild dogs. Selous is one of the best places in Africa to see these majestic animals in their natural habitat.
- Boat Safaris: Explore the Rufiji River and its floodplains on a boat safari, providing opportunities to see hippos, crocodiles, and a wide range of bird species from a unique perspective.
- Walking Safaris: Experience the bush on foot with expert guides who offer insights into the smaller details of the ecosystem, track animal movements, and ensure a safe and immersive adventure.
- Bird Watching: With over 400 bird species, including rare and endemic varieties, Selous is a paradise for bird watchers. Look out for species such as the African skimmer and white-backed vulture.
3. Best Time to Visit
The optimal time for a safari in Selous varies based on your interests:
- Dry Season (June to October): This is the best time for wildlife viewing as animals congregate around water sources and the vegetation is less dense, making it easier to spot game.
- Wet Season (November to May): The wet season transforms the landscape with lush greenery and vibrant flora, ideal for bird watching and seeing the park’s rejuvenated environment. However, some areas may be less accessible due to rain.

5. Activities and Experiences
Beyond traditional game drives, Selous provides a variety of activities to enhance your safari experience:
- Guided Walking Safaris: Explore the reserve on foot with knowledgeable guides who provide insights into the flora and fauna and offer a closer look at the natural world.
- Fishing Safaris: Try your hand at fishing in the Rufiji River for species like tigerfish and catfish. Local guides can help you with techniques and locations.

6. Practical Travel Tips
To ensure a smooth and enjoyable safari experience in Selous, keep the following tips in mind:
- Travel Logistics: Selous is accessible by light aircraft from Dar es Salaam or other major Tanzanian cities. Plan your travel logistics in advance to arrange flights and transfers.
- Health Precautions: Ensure you have the necessary vaccinations and malaria prophylaxis before your trip. Consult with a travel health specialist for specific recommendations.
- Pack Accordingly: Bring lightweight, breathable clothing for daytime, warmer layers for cooler evenings, and rain gear if traveling during the wet season. Essential items include binoculars, a camera, and a field guide for wildlife and birds.
